Ohio Resignation Letter for Work refers to a formal letter written by an employee in the state of Ohio to notify their employer about their intent to resign from their current job position. This letter serves as a professional means of communication to inform the employer about the employee's decision to terminate their employment contract. The Ohio Resignation Letter for Work typically includes specific information such as the employee's name, position, and the effective date of resignation. It is important to mention the effective date as it determines when the employee will officially cease working for the company. The letter may also state the reason behind the employee's decision to resign, although providing this information is optional. There are different types of Ohio Resignation Letters for Work that an employee may choose from, depending on their specific circumstance. Some of these types include: 1. Basic Resignation Letter: This is a standard resignation letter that simply notifies the employer about the employee's decision to resign without delving into specific details or reasons. 2. Two-Week Notice Resignation Letter: This type of resignation letter is commonly used when an employee intends to leave the company but wants to provide a two-week notice period. It is considered a professional courtesy and allows the employer to make necessary arrangements to fill the vacated position. 3. Immediate Resignation Letter: In certain situations, an employee may need to resign immediately without providing any notice due to unforeseen circumstances or personal emergencies. An immediate resignation letter is used to communicate this urgency to the employer. 4. Resignation Letter with Notice Period Extension: If an employee wants to extend their notice period beyond the standard two-week period, they can use this type of letter to formally request the extension and provide a valid reason for the request. Regardless of the type of Ohio Resignation Letter for Work chosen, it is crucial to maintain a professional tone throughout the letter. The employee should express gratitude for the opportunities and experiences gained during their employment and offer assistance in the transition process. This helps to maintain positive relationships and ensure a smooth exit from the company.

In Ohio, employers and employees are free to terminate the employment relationship for any or no reason, so long that the reason is not in violation of state or federal law.

You must have just cause to quit, as defined by Ohio law, to be eligible for unemployment. That means a compelling, job-related reason that would cause any reasonable person to quit, such as being forced to work in unsafe conditions.

In California, there is generally no requirement that an employee or an employer give two weeks notice, or any notice, before quitting or terminating a job. This is because California is an at-will employment state. At-will employment laws mean that employers can layoff, fire, or let their employees go at any time.

There is no lawful requirement that an employee provide at least two weeks' notice before they end their employment. Although two weeks' notice is common and viewed as a polite manner to handle a separation, an employer cannot simply decide that it doesn't wish to pay an employee their final wages.

There are no federal or state laws that require you to give two weeks' notice before leaving your job. Therefore, you are not legally obliged to provide two weeks' notice. However, some employment contracts include procedures for terminating the contract.

What Happens If You Don't Give 2 Weeks' Notice? You could break the provisions of your contract, and that could have legal repercussions. If you have no choice, then notifying your employer and giving as much notice as possible (or perhaps even working out a new deal) can potentially make the fallout less serious.

If you quit your job, you won't be eligible for unemployment benefits unless you had just cause to leave your job. In general, just cause means that you had a compelling, job-related reason for leaving the position and a reasonably careful person would have done the same in your circumstances.
